This is all for the A2A Cessna.

Here's another, along the same idea as RZX: VH-RND. You'll notice more or less the same paint pattern, but now with bare metal above and below as it looked in 1967. RZX originally looked like this as well. Both RZX and RND were registered in 1967, and both are still going strong, though birds, these Cessna's. RDN was originally supposed to be VH-KOA, but was bought by the Royal Newcastle Aero Club, and they changed the registration to RND. It is cuurently registered in Victoria.
